    An extraordinary underground boat trip in the mine network below Alderley Edge in Cheshire, England. Access is largely enabled and curated by the considerable energies of the Derbyshire Caving Club, these copper mines date back to the Bronze Age, and feature extensively in the writings of Alan Garner.

    Hi george, since you are a hovercraft fan, here is a video of a hovercraft who was rescued in the Netherlands by KNRM (rescue squad). Proves a hovercraft, especially a self-built, isn't always safe. The hovercraft capsized, the driver was hurt at his leg and couldn't move in the shallow and cold water. The rescue team were dressed in drysuits. It was a succesfull recovery except for the wreck of the hovercraft.

    I used a 20 container to make a spare bedroom with a small second room for shower and toilet at the family property in Central Texas. Kind of cozy but comfortable. The end doors open up to expose a screen wall for ventilation in the summer.
